Revive has mastered something tricky in the consignment world: pricing items fairly for both sellers and buyers. Reviewers consistently praise the reasonable prices, with one person scoring Juicy Couture heels for just eight dollars.

Another found a gorgeous red vase she couldn’t resist because the price made it impossible to walk away.

The store takes a 60/40 split with consignors after deducting a small processing fee. This arrangement keeps prices competitive while ensuring sellers earn decent returns.

You’ll find higher-end items priced well below retail without the inflated tags some consignment shops use.

They even offer layaway plans for bigger purchases, making furniture and larger items accessible to more shoppers. This flexibility shows they understand budgets vary and not everyone can pay upfront.

Revive operates under Jubilee Church ownership, and this connection influences everything about the shopping experience. Worship music plays throughout the store, creating a peaceful atmosphere that many reviewers specifically appreciate.

This isn’t about pushing religion on customers; it’s about providing a calm, positive environment.

The church’s values of community and service translate into how the business operates. Staff members treat customers with genuine care rather than just processing transactions.

This mission-driven approach explains why the atmosphere feels different from typical consignment shops.
